Macrophages: The Destroyers

Before we move on from the innate immune system, let’s go through all the cell types one by one, so that we can better understand them. Let’s start with macrophages, which are long-lived phagocytic cells. They play a pivotal role in recognition, phagocytosis, and degradation of cellular debris and pathogens.
